Output 766fc06a53e15516dac4eba0f5487a4bd152470fef5ef79ab3b7ad581cb83650:1

value
17371753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d064e9a539eb47a2f98411a3fd1a8f21ebf049c2 OP_EQUAL
address
3LguMyojocArdSbnNHcscjQogxR1ZSCqak
transaction
766fc06a53e15516dac4eba0f5487a4bd152470fef5ef79ab3b7ad581cb83650
spent
true